JSPS is a Japanese research funding agency. JSPS supports all research
fields, such as physics, mathematics, chemistry, engineering, geology,
computer sciences, biomedical sciences, humanity and social sciences
etc. JSPS’s main missions are (1) to distribute research grants; (2) to
provide fellowships to Japanese young researchers; (3) to carry out
international programs; and (4) to support university reform. Through
its third mission, in addition to the international cooperative programs
which JSPS runs with nearly 90 overseas counterpart agencies such as NSF
or NIH, JSPS also offers various invitation fellowship programs to Japan
for overseas researchers and graduate students in accordance with each
research career. Through these programs JSPS supports thousands of
researchers/graduate students exchanges every year
